Sue Lewis was an accountant in 1943 and earned $12,000 that year. Her son is an accountant too and he earned $220,000 this year. Suppose the price index was 18.9 in 1943 and 20.5 in the current year. Sue's 1943 income in current year dollars is

Answers

Answer 15,000

Explanation:

Sue's 1943 income in the current year dollars is $13,016.

The price index reflects the average level of prices and can be used to compute the relative differences in the prices of the same basket of goods between some periods.

Data and Calculations:

Sue's 1943 income = $12,000

Son's income in the current year = $220,000

Price index in 1943 = 18.9

Price index in the current year = 20.5

Sue's 1943 income in current year dollars = $13,016 ($12,000 x 20.5/18.9)

Thus, Sue's earnings in 1943 is $13,016 in current year dollars.
